Portfolio overview

GPCP IP Holdings LLC has been granted 331 US utility patents between 2017 and 2025, placing GPCP IP Holdings LLC at rank #1,276 across all assignees tracked by PlainPatent. This portfolio spans 88 distinct Cooperative Patent Classification (CPC) subclasses, averaging 19.6 claims per patent with primary concentration in D21H (PULP COMPOSITIONS; PREPARATION THEREOF NOT COVERED BY SUBCLASSES D21C OR D21D; IMPREGNATING OR COATING OF PAPER; TREATMENT OF FINISHED PAPER NOT COVERED BY CLASS B31 OR SUBCLASS D21G; PAPER NOT OTHERW). As a US Corporation, GPCP IP Holdings LLC is one of the broader-portfolio assignees in the PatentsView dataset. The composite Innovation Score of 59.7/100 blends portfolio volume, filing velocity, technology breadth, and claim depth into a single comparable measure drawn directly from USPTO PatentsView records.

Filing cadence tells the strategic story. Between 2020 and 2025 the company received 188 grants, compared with 143 in the 2015–2019 window — a +31% shift in five-year velocity. GPCP IP Holdings LLC patent grants by year, 2015–2025
Year Patents Granted Share of Period
2017 11 3.3%
2018 59 17.8%
2019 73 22.1%
2020 64 19.3%
2021 38 11.5%
2022 26 7.9%
2023 34 10.3%
2024 16 4.8%
2025 10 3.0%
